Dover House Cormont Road London Lambeth SE5 9RE
T1 London Plane: Reduce branches away from the property footprint by 2-3m to clear the property and mitigate issues associated with branches overhanging the property and improve light, reduce the remainder by 2-3m to maintain shape and maintain tree at current dimensions, mitigate root activity as not yet reached full grown size or potential, thin remainder by 10% T2 London Plane: Reduce branches away from the property footprint by 2-3m to clear the property and mitigate issues associated with branches overhanging the property and improve light, reduce the remainder by 2-3m to maintain shape and maintain tree at current dimensions, mitigate root activity as not yet reached full grown size or potential, thin remainder by 10% Council Note: Following investigation, it has been confirmed that the London Plane trees subject of this notification are protected by Tree Preservation Order No. 528 (2025), made on 22 December 2025. The section 211 Conservation Area notification does not state that the trees are subject to a Tree Preservation Order. As the trees are protected, section 211 of the Town and Country Planning Act 1990 does not apply. This notification has therefore been withdrawn by the Council. Any proposed works to the trees must be submitted as a Tree Preservation Order application and determined in accordance with the Town and Country Planning (Tree Preservation) (England) Regulations 2012.

Dover House Cormont Road London Lambeth SE5 9RE
Tree Preservation Order 528 (2025), Dover House, Cormont Road. T1 London plane: Reduce the crown spread on the east and south-east sides, facing Dover House, by up to 3m. The finished crown alignment shall extend no further towards the building than the edge of the gravel area between the tree and Dover House, as shown in Photograph 8 of the submitted Tree Inspection Report dated 3 February 2026, reference TI05012601. Raise the crown base on the north side overhanging the adjoining property to provide a clearance of 4m above ground level. T2 London plane: Reduce the crown spread on the east side, facing Dover House, by up to 3m. The finished crown alignment shall extend no further towards the building than 1m from the building-side edge of the gravel area between the tree and Dover House, as shown in Photograph 9 of the submitted Tree Inspection Report dated 3 February 2026, reference TI05012601. Reduce the identified long, low branch on the south-east side overhanging the adjoining property by 3m to 4m, as shown in Photograph 9. All proposed pruning works shall be carried out to suitable growth points, retaining balanced crown forms, and to a satisfactory arboricultural standard in accordance with BS 3998:2010 Tree Work Recommendations. The application separately refers to removal of deadwood exceeding 20mm diameter. Removal of dead branches from a living tree does not require consent and therefore does not form part of the works assessed under this application. Photographs 8 and 9 within the submitted Tree Inspection Report form part of the submitted specification.
